Werder Bremen lose 1:2 against Hansa Rostock

Bundesliga soccer team Werder Bremen lost a test match against Hansa Rostock after taking the lead. On Thursday, coach Ole Werner's team conceded 1:2 (1:1) against the second division team in Bremen. Justin Njinmah (18th minute) scored for Bremen. Kai Pröger (45') and Simon Rhein (61') were successful for Rostock.

The club from Mecklenburg-Vorpommern had the first chance of the game, but Pröger (4th) failed to beat Werder goalkeeper Jiri Pavlenka. After a high pass from Dawid Kownacki, Njinmah scored under pressure to give Werder the lead.

Despite the early deficit, the 13th-placed team in the 2nd division impressed: Serhat-Semih Güler (27) hit the crossbar, Pröger did better just before the half-time whistle. Rhein scored the decisive goal for Hansa with a well-taken free-kick.
